/* Genode includes */
#include <rm_session/rm_session.h>
using namespace Genode;
/**
* Return single instance of the context-area RM-session
*
* In base-hw core this object is never used because contexts
* get allocated through the phys-mem allocator. Anyways the
* accessor must exist because generic main-thread startup calls
* it to ensure that common allocations do not steal context area.
*/
namespace Genode { Rm_session * env_context_area_rm_session() { return 0; } }
